Honestly it depends on your needs. If you go with the 5.3 V8, I expect much of the drivetrain is similar (engine, tranny, 8.6 rear). The I6 is very reliable and has plenty of umph especially with a tune.
If you need the space get a Tahoe, if you want to go on tighter trails and easier to park when not wheeling get the TB.
While we likely don't have the amount of aftermarket support that a Tahoe would I would say there is enough support to do most anything this IFS platform can handle.
If I were to be in the market for another SUV, I would likely get a V8 TB EXT(aka wiener dog) because I could use the extra people space.
